Sun Visor Replacement for 2004 Toyota RAV4: A Complete Guide

Replacing the sun visor in a 2004 Toyota RAV4 is a straightforward task that can enhance your driving experience by improving visibility and comfort. This guide provides step-by-step instructions on how to effectively replace the sun visor, ensuring you have all the necessary tools and information at hand.
Understanding the Need for Replacement
Over time, sun visors can become worn out, damaged, or fail to stay in place, which can be both distracting and unsafe while driving. If your sun visor is sagging or has broken clips, it’s essential to replace it promptly. The replacement process is simple and can be done without professional help, saving you time and money.
Tools Required for Replacement
Before you begin, gather the following tools:
- Plastic trim removal tool
- New sun visor (specific to 2004 RAV4)
- Screwdriver (if necessary)
Step-by-Step Replacement Process
1. Remove the Old Sun Visor
- Start by locating the plastic cover at the base of the sun visor. Use a plastic trim removal tool to gently pry off this cover.
- Once the cover is removed, you will see the mounting screws or clips holding the visor in place. If there are screws, use a screwdriver to remove them.
2. Disconnect Any Wiring
- If your sun visor has built-in lights or other electronic features, carefully disconnect any wiring harnesses attached to it. Make sure to do this gently to avoid damaging the connectors.
3. Install the New Sun Visor
- Align the new sun visor with the mounting points. If there were screws, insert them and tighten securely.
- For clip installations, push the visor into place until you hear a click indicating it’s secured.
4. Reattach the Plastic Cover
- Once the new visor is installed, replace the plastic cover by snapping it back into position.
5. Test Functionality
- Ensure that the new sun visor moves up and down smoothly and that any lights function correctly if applicable.
Important Considerations
- Choosing a Replacement: Make sure to purchase a sun visor compatible with your 2004 Toyota RAV4 model. Aftermarket options are available and can often be more affordable than OEM parts.
- Safety Precautions: Always disconnect your vehicle’s battery when working with electrical components to prevent any short circuits or electrical shocks.
FAQs About Sun Visor Replacement
- How much does it cost to replace a sun visor?
The cost of a new sun visor can vary widely depending on whether you choose an OEM or aftermarket part, typically ranging from $20 to $100. - Can I replace my sun visor myself?
Yes, replacing a sun visor is a DIY task that requires minimal tools and basic mechanical skills. - What if my new sun visor doesn’t fit?
If your new sun visor doesn’t fit properly, check if you ordered the correct part for your specific model year.
